We invite you to be part of Boeing's Commercial Derivative Airplane program, where you will have the exceptional chance to contribute to a next-generation Proprietary Program. This role is integral to the Commercial Derivative Airplane Planning team.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Deliver shipside Manufacturing Engineering assistance to Mechanics and other support teams on the VC25B program, including providing engineering clarifications and drafting work instructions for Non-Conformances.
  • Refine, validate, coordinate, and implement conceptual designs while managing the program architecture for production.
  • Develop and oversee manufacturing plans, ensuring optimization of processes.
  • Conduct intricate producibility and variation analyses to confirm that manufacturing capabilities align with requirements.
  • Address complex technical challenges effectively.
  • Act as a project manager to ensure integration and maintenance of contract requirements, specifications, design criteria, and schedule performance.
  • Lead innovative design solutions and support the exploration of new product or business opportunities.
  • Apply Lean Enterprise analysis methods within the company.
  • Document and disseminate best practices in producibility.
  • Provide structured mentoring and guidance to team members.
  • Availability for overtime, weekends, and holidays may be necessary to meet business needs.

Security Clearance Requirement: This position necessitates the ability to obtain a U.S. Security Clearance, which requires U.S. Citizenship.

Work Environment: This role is expected to be 100% onsite, requiring the selected candidate to work at one of the designated locations.

Essential Qualifications:

  • A Bachelor of Science degree from an accredited program in engineering, engineering technology, chemistry, physics, mathematics, data science, or computer science.
  • A minimum of 5 years of experience in reading and interpreting engineering drawings.
  • At least 5 years of experience in applying professional/technical writing skills and collaborating effectively to resolve technical issues.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Strong preference for candidates who can obtain program access, requiring U.S. Citizenship.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ite.
  • Familiarity with CATIA, IVT, and GoldEsp.

Typical Education & Experience:

Education and experience typically acquired through advanced technical education from an accredited program in engineering, computer science, mathematics, physics, or chemistry (e.g., Bachelor) and generally 5 or more years of related work experience or an equivalent combination of technical education and experience.
